Geocel 2300: The Pro’s Go-To Overall Sealant

Geocel 2300 is a tripolymer sealant that bridges the gap between high-performance industrial adhesives and everyday roofing repairs. It is the workhorse of the trade because it maintains a tenacious grip on almost any surface, including damp or slightly oily metal.

This sealant is particularly effective because it remains flexible through extreme temperature fluctuations. Where rigid, cheaper caulks eventually crack under the constant expansion and contraction cycles of a metal roof, the 2300 moves with the material.

However, keep in mind that it is solvent-based and possesses a strong odor during application. Ensure adequate ventilation if working on an enclosed porch roof or near an intake vent.

Lexel: Best Crystal-Clear Paintable Sealant

When the aesthetic of the roof is just as important as the seal, Lexel is the industry standard for invisible protection. It is a synthetic rubber sealant that is significantly clearer than traditional silicones and far more durable than acrylics.

The major advantage here is its superior adhesion to a wide range of surfaces, from wood and brick to painted metal. Unlike silicone, which notoriously resists paint, Lexel can be painted over once it has fully cured, making it the top choice for sealing fasteners on colored trim or flashing.

Be aware that Lexel has a high degree of “stretch,” which is great for movement but makes it a bit stringy to apply. Use a controlled, steady pull on the trigger to avoid messy trailing.

Titebond Metal Roof: Best for Metal Panels

Metal roofing requires a sealant specifically engineered to withstand the unique chemistry of coated steel and aluminum. Titebond Metal Roof sealant is formulated to provide an aggressive bond that won’t react negatively with metal coatings or cause corrosion.

This product shines in high-wind scenarios where fasteners are subjected to constant vibration. It creates a semi-rigid bond that holds the fastener head tightly against the washer, preventing the “wobble” that eventually elongates the hole and invites leaks.

For the best results, ensure the metal surface is free of factory-applied oils or lubricants. A quick wipe with a solvent-dampened rag before application ensures the bond is chemical-tight rather than just mechanical.

OSI Quad Max: The Toughest All-Weather Choice

OSI Quad Max is often spec’d for exterior window and door installations, but its performance on roofing transitions and fastener heads is top-tier. It is designed to be applied in temperatures ranging from freezing cold to scorching heat, making it the ultimate tool for year-round roof work.

The standout feature of Quad Max is its UV resistance. While many sealants chalk or degrade under intense sunlight after two or three seasons, this product stays intact and maintains its color and flexibility for years.

If the project involves high-slope, high-exposure conditions, this is the sealant to use. It doesn’t slump, meaning it stays exactly where it is placed, even when applied to vertical flashing or steep roof pitches.

Dicor Self-Leveling: For Low-Slope & RV Roofs

Self-leveling sealants are essential for horizontal roof surfaces where water tends to pool around fastener heads or overlapping seams. Dicor is the industry leader for this, as it is designed to flow into the microscopic gaps and cracks around the fastener without the need for manual tooling.

This sealant is a game-changer for flat or low-slope roofs where water sitting on a fastener head is a constant threat. As it cures, it creates a smooth, rounded mound that sheds water away from the penetration point like a miniature roof peak.

Never use self-leveling sealants on steep slopes; they will simply run down the roof before they can cure. Stick to non-sag varieties for anything with a pitch greater than 2/12.

Through the ROOF!: Best for Wet Applications

In the reality of professional roofing, waiting for the perfect dry day isn’t always an option. Through the ROOF! is a unique co-polymer sealant designed specifically to stick to wet surfaces and seal leaks during active rain events.

This is an essential item in any service truck’s emergency kit. If a leak is detected mid-storm, this sealant provides an immediate, reliable patch that doesn’t wash away or lose its bond while setting up.

Remember that while it performs in the rain, it is not a permanent replacement for proper flashing. Use it to stabilize a situation, but inspect the fastener and underlying flashing as soon as the weather clears.

Sealant Chemistry: Urethane vs. Silicone vs. Butyl

Understanding the chemistry behind the sealant dictates its performance and lifespan. Choose the right chemistry to avoid premature failure:

  • Polyurethanes: Offer high durability and are paintable, but they can be difficult to remove once cured.
  • Silicones: Provide excellent flexibility and UV resistance, but they are generally not paintable and can leave a residue that prevents future repairs from sticking.
  • Butyls: The classic choice for concealed roof seams; they stay permanently tacky and don’t harden, making them perfect for movement-heavy areas.

Match the chemistry to the job. If the seal will be exposed to constant water and heavy movement, reach for a high-grade hybrid or polyurethane. If it’s a hidden seam under a ridge cap, butyl tape or sealant is often the superior, non-hardening choice.

How to Prep a Fastener Head for a Perfect Seal

The longevity of a sealant bond is directly proportional to the cleanliness of the substrate. If you apply sealant over a layer of dust, moss, or factory oils, the sealant will eventually peel away, regardless of how high-quality the product is.

  • Clean: Wipe the fastener and surrounding metal with a lint-free rag and a suitable cleaner.
  • Dry: Ensure the area is moisture-free unless using a specialized wet-application product.
  • Check: Verify that the fastener head is properly seated. If the neoprene washer is crushed or missing, replace the fastener before sealing.

A quick swipe with a bit of denatured alcohol goes a long way in removing the thin oil films left behind by manufacturing processes. This simple step is what separates a amateur leak repair from a professional, long-term seal.

Caulking Gun Tips for a Clean Professional Bead

Achieving a clean, consistent bead of sealant is as much about technique as it is about the gun you use. A high-ratio thrust gun—ideally 18:1 or higher—is necessary for thick roofing sealants, as it reduces hand fatigue and ensures a steady flow.

Cut the nozzle at a 45-degree angle to match the size of the fastener head, and keep the nozzle pressed firmly against the surface. Avoid the common mistake of “painting” the bead with your finger; this spreads the sealant too thin and ruins the structural integrity of the seal.

If you need a smooth finish, use a light misting of soapy water and a professional finishing tool. This allows you to press the sealant into the gap without it sticking to your finger or tool, resulting in a crisp, clean aesthetic.

When to Re-Seal vs. When to Replace a Fastener

A common mistake is trying to save a failing fastener by burying it in excessive amounts of sealant. If the fastener is rusted, stripped, or the rubber grommet is dry-rotted and brittle, no amount of sealant will hold for long.

If you notice “red rust” bleeding from around the fastener head, the metal has already been compromised by oxidation. In this case, pull the fastener, clean the hole, and replace it with a new one of a slightly larger diameter to ensure a tight, fresh bite into the decking.

Sealant should always be considered a secondary line of defense, not a primary fix for hardware that has reached the end of its service life. When in doubt, pulling the old screw and replacing it is the only way to guarantee the integrity of the roof system.
